Clogged Drain Repair in Denver, CO
Clogged drain repair services address issues related to blocked or slow-moving drains in residential properties. This service covers a range of projects, including kitchen sinks, bathroom drains, laundry lines, and outdoor drainage systems. Property owners typically seek professional assistance when experiencing persistent clogs, foul odors, or water backups that cannot be resolved with basic plunging or chemical solutions, ensuring proper drainage and preventing further water damage.
Before requesting clogged drain repair, homeowners usually want to understand the cause of the blockage, the scope of the repair, and any potential disruptions during the service. Common causes include accumulated debris, grease buildup, hair, or foreign objects. Clarifying the methods used for clearing the clog and whether pipe repairs or replacements are necessary can help property owners make informed decisions. Proper diagnosis and effective repair help maintain the functionality of plumbing systems and avoid costly future issues.

Clogged Drain Repair Questions
What causes drain clogs in homes? Common causes include hair, grease, soap residue, and foreign objects blocking pipes over time.
How can I tell if a drain is clogged? Signs include slow drainage, gurgling sounds, or standing water in sinks or tubs.
Are chemical drain cleaners effective? Chemical cleaners may provide temporary relief but can damage pipes and often don't resolve stubborn clogs.
What are typical methods for repairing clogged drains? Techniques include snaking, hydro jetting, and pipe inspection to remove blockages and restore flow.
